Now that I relocated to Canada (and it was a pain to get the Vette across) and that the Vette will not see day light from November to March, the good news is that I will have plenty of time for big projects (and I have quite a big list).

The bad news is trying to get parts at a decent price over here.
I found a few parts house in BC, but I'm on the East side (Montreal).
 
There should be some big ones in Ontario, but my search hasn't been too good so far.
 
I know all the big ones (Bairs, Ecklers, Summit, Corvette America...) all ship to Canada, but you have to add a lot more shipping charges, plus taxes (15% over here) + customs.  Customs is anybody's guess, it could be up to 25% sometimes.   So you see that even if Ecklers says "no problem; I can ship it..."  it doesn't matter; when I pickup, I pay on delivery an extra 20 to 40%.
 
SO, I am looking for a Canadian warehouse of C3 parts.  This winter, I will go for either the suspension or redo the whole interior.
 
Any idea on Canadian suppliers ?

74-454 I did get a quote from a Interior supply company from the East they were NOS Reproductions. They seemed a little high price wise but were quick and very eager to answer my questions. Hope this helps and welcome back to the Great White North. You also probably tried Corvette Specialties in Surrey/Vancouver already. They are very knowledgable and have a few C3's that they have restored quite nicely.

 One of the sponsors of the Nova Scotia Corvette Club Is Blair Molands!!
He is located in Bridgewater, Nova Scotia
If you go to the Clubs WebSight you will find an address and phone # for them. He has a field full of used parts and a warehouse full of new retail items.
